What can you expect from a Professional Chaplain?
A Professional Chaplain is Educated, Endorsed, Experienced and understands what it means to work in a multi-faith environment.
Educated: Our Chaplains have received a Masters of Divinity or equivalent degree, and many have earned a Doctor of Ministry degree from an accredited Seminary or institution. These degrees specifically prepare them for faith based ministry. Many Chaplains also have secondary Masters level degrees such as Pastoral Counseling.
Endorsed: Our Chaplains are endorsed by a Federally recognized Endorsing Agent - the same recognition required by the Military. This means that each Chaplain belongs to a legitimate and internationally recognized organization and has met requirements and standards of that organization to include education, background checks, and personal and professional recommendations.
Experienced: Our Chaplains have a track record. They have at minimum 5-10 years of supervised ministry. Most of our Chaplains have already served a career in the Military or in another capacity as a Chaplain. They understand ministry, and they are experts. They know what it means to serve a wide variety of people in a complex and challenging environment. They have what it takes.
Multi-faith Environment: You can call it multi-faith, you can call it pluralistic, it simply means that every Chaplain will respect the faith of each person they meet including people who do not claim a faith. Chaplains are not there to proselytize or evangelize. Chaplains are not there to criticize or debate. Chaplains are there to care for and help facilitate the faith of anyone they encounter.
